JavaScript Array with()
- الصفحة السابقة valueOf()
- الصفحة التالية []
- العودة إلى الطبقة السابقة مرجع JavaScript Array
التعريف والاستخدام
مع ()
الطريقة تستخدم لتعديل العناصر المحددة في المستوى التكرار.
مع ()
الطريقة تعود مستوى تكرار جديد.
مع ()
الطريقة لا تغير المستوى التكرار الأصلي.
المثال
أضاف ES2023 مع ()
الطريقة، كطريقة آمنة لتعديل عناصر المستوى التكرار دون تغيير المستوى التكرار الأصلي:
const months = ["Januar", "Februar", "Mar", "April"]; const myMonths = months.with(2, "March");
النص
array.with(index, القيمة)
المعاملات
المعاملات | وصف |
---|---|
index |
مطلوب. index (الموقع) للعنصر الذي سيتم تغييره. الindexes السلبية تبدأ من نهاية المستوى التكرار. |
القيمة | مطلوب. القيمة الجديدة. |
القيمة المقدمة
نوع | وصف |
---|---|
مستوى التكرار | مستوى التكرار جديد يحتوي على العناصر المعدلة. |
دعم المتصفح
مع ()
هي خاصية ES2023.
من يوليو 2023، جميع المتصفحات الحديثة تدعم هذا الطريقة:
Chrome | Edge | Firefox | Safari | Opera |
---|---|---|---|---|
Chrome 110 | Edge 110 | Firefox 115 | Safari 16.4 | Opera 96 |
2023 فبراير | 2023 فبراير | 2023 يوليو | 2023 مارس | 2023 مارس |
- الصفحة السابقة valueOf()
- الصفحة التالية []
- العودة إلى الطبقة السابقة مرجع JavaScript Array